Read moreVery nice experience. Easy to book. The surroundings are very beautiful and the river you go through is a small piece of nature paradise. The water is cold but very clear and nice to swim in. Guide (Calvin) was really nice and thorough in his briefing. Also very patient towards the kids. The first part is more calm. The second part has more rapids. At this moment (August 2025) You have to walk between part one and two for about twenty minutes because the water is too low. So keep this in mind if you don’t walk too well. The second part was supposed to be an hour but was not even half an hour so that was disappointing but that’s probably because of the low water. Photo’s are made on an dated camera, and you get low resolution photos? (Why not use a GoPro like everyone else?) and you get an USB stick with everyone of your groups photos for 19€. Levels 1 and 2 are great fun, love the short rapids and the mini waterfall we went down. Refreshing water in the river and you can get photos and videos. If you want you can take a dip into the water and let the current take you to your raft. Good quality equipment. They will provide wetsuits and safety equipment, you just have to bring your swimming costume, full change of clothes, towels and an extra T-shirt. It has been amazing.
